AEK leads with perfect record

Frontrunner AEK maintained both its lead and perfect record in the Super League after five rounds of play with a 1-0 win over Larissa Saturday.

AEK took the lead early in the game, in the fourth minute of play when Brazilian midfielder Gustavo Manduca dribbled past two defenders and unleashed a powerful shot from 20 meters.

Also Saturday, defending champion Olympiakos defeated Panionios 4-1 at home to maintain second place, four points behind AEK.

In Thessaloniki last night, Aris defeated local rival PAOK 3-1 to remain fourth, six points behind AEK. Panathinakos earned a valuable 2-0 win at Veria yesterday for third spot on 10 points. In other games, it was: Apollon Kalamaria-Ergotelis, 2-1; OFI-Asteras Tripoli, 0-3; Levadiakos-Xanthi, 2-1. Atromitos was due to host Iraklis later last night.
